Understanding Wine and Proton

What is Wine?

Wine (Wine Is Not an Emulator) runs Windows applications on Linux.

How it works:

  • Translates Windows API calls to Linux
  • No virtualization needed
  • Direct execution

What is Proton?

Proton is Steam's Wine fork optimized for gaming.

Features:

  • Pre-configured for games
  • Better compatibility
  • Regular updates

Wine Installation

Install Wine

Arch/CachyOS:

# Install Wine
sudo pacman -S wine wine-mono wine-gecko

# For 32-bit support
sudo pacman -S lib32-mesa lib32-vulkan-icd-loader

Debian/Ubuntu:

sudo apt install wine wine64 wine32

Fedora:

sudo dnf install wine

Install Winetricks

Winetricks helper:

# Arch/CachyOS
sudo pacman -S winetricks

# Debian/Ubuntu
sudo apt install winetricks

# Fedora
sudo dnf install winetricks

Wine Configuration

Initialize Wine

First setup:

# Initialize Wine prefix
winecfg

# This creates ~/.wine

Configure Wine

Wine configuration:

# Open Wine config
winecfg

# Configure:
# - Windows version
# - Graphics settings
# - Audio settings
# - Libraries

Proton Setup

Steam Proton

Enable in Steam:

  1. SteamSettingsSteam Play
  2. Enable Steam Play for all titles
  3. Select Proton version

Proton-GE

Install Proton-GE:

# Download from GitHub
# https://github.com/GloriousEggroll/proton-ge-custom

# Extract to:
~/.steam/steam/compatibilitytools.d/

# Restart Steam

Running Applications

Run Windows Application

Using Wine:

# Run executable
wine application.exe

# Or install first
wine setup.exe

Using Winetricks

Install dependencies:

# Install Visual C++ runtime
winetricks vcrun2019

# Install DirectX
winetricks d3dx9

# Install fonts
winetricks corefonts

Troubleshooting

Application Not Running

Check Wine version:

# Check Wine version
wine --version

# Check if 32-bit or 64-bit
wine64 --version

Missing Dependencies

Install libraries:

# Use winetricks
winetricks dll-name

# Or manually
wine regsvr32 dll-name.dll
